A vapor shipper is a specialized container used to transport temperature-sensitive items safely and securely. It utilizes a technology known as vapor-phase cooling to maintain the desired temperature inside the container for an extended period. The use of a vapor shipper ensures that the products being shipped are kept at the required temperature throughout the journey, even if it involves long distances or multiple transit points.
The key component of a vapor shipper is the vapor phase coolant, usually liquid nitrogen or dry ice, which is used to create a cold environment inside the container. This coolant does not come into direct contact with the products being shipped, reducing the risk of temperature fluctuations or damage. Instead, it evaporates to cool the surrounding air and maintain a consistent and stable temperature inside the vapor shipper.
One of the main advantages of using a vapor shipper is its passive cooling system, which eliminates the need for external power sources or batteries. This makes it an ideal solution for shipping temperature-sensitive items to remote or off-grid locations where access to electricity may be limited. The self-contained nature of a vapor shipper also reduces the risk of temperature excursions caused by power outages, mechanical failures, or human error during transit.
